Methods and systems for providing user feedback using an emotion scale

1. A method, comprising:
- at a client device having a touch-sensitive display, one or more processors, and memory storing instructions for execution by the one or more processors;
displaying a content item;
displaying, concurrently with and separately from the content item, a plurality of affordances in a user-interaction area, including a user-feedback affordance for providing feedback for the content item;
detecting, via the touch-sensitive display, a first user input at a first display location corresponding to the user-feedback affordance;
in response to detecting the first user input and while the first user input remains in contact with the touch-sensitive display;
displaying a first facial expression superimposed on the content item; and
concurrently with and separately from displaying the first facial expression, replacing display of the plurality of affordances with a range of facial expressions in the user-interaction area, each facial expression of the range of facial expressions corresponding to a respective opinion of a range of opinions, wherein the range of facial expressions includes at least three facial expressions corresponding to respective opinions of the range of opinions that vary monotonically from a first extreme to a second extreme, each successive opinion in the range of opinions corresponding to a greater degree of approval or disapproval than the preceding opinion;
detecting, via the touch-sensitive display, a second user input at a second display location, distinct from the first display location, corresponding to a respective facial expression of the range of facial expressions, wherein the first and second user inputs comprise a continuous contact that begins with the first user input; and
in response to detecting the second user input and while the second user input remains in contact with the touch-sensitive display at the second display location, updating the first facial expression superimposed on the content item to match the respective facial expression.

Abstract
A client device displays a content item and a first facial expression superimposed on the content item. Concurrently with and separately from displaying the first facial expression, a range of emotion indicators is displayed, each emotion indicator of the range of emotion indicators corresponding to a respective opinion of a range of opinions. A first user input is detected at a display location corresponding to a respective emotion indicator of the range of emotion indicators. In response to detecting the first user input, the first facial expression is updated to match the respective emotion indicator.
